At the March 22, 2016, meeting, the Board authorized providing up to $22 million to study ways to improve treatment of chronic low back pain, a leading cause of disability and one of the most frequent reasons adults seek medical care. Additionally, the Board approved $12.5 million for five Patient-Powered Research Network (PPRN) demonstration projects. (Read more)

All PCORI Board meetings are open to the public. This meeting was held via teleconference/webinar with no public comment period.
